on sounddomain.com there's a general writeup for doing the big 3, but it was done on a mustang which looked way easier than what I plan on doing on the max. Their alternator is right on top of engine whereas the max has its alt hidden to side and looks very difficult to get to. I might do a write up for it if anybody wants it. I plan on getting it done by mid day saturday. My 1/0 gauge wire and battery terminals from knukoncepts is supposed to get here by tommarow (friday) according to UPS.
As far as batteries are concerned I've read numerous posts as different forums and there's not much of an advatage with a battery upgrade unless you run your stereo with your car off. You're pretty much running off the alternator once the engine is running. I tried this on my old car it drove perfectly normal with the battery completly disconnected with the headlights and stereo on.
